Importance of Water Control in Mortars

Water control is a critical aspect of mortar production, as it directly impacts the strength, durability, and workability of the final product. Excessive water in mortar can lead to shrinkage, cracking, and reduced bond strength, while insufficient water can result in poor workability and inadequate hydration of cement particles. To address these challenges, manufacturers often turn to chemical admixtures such as Kima MHEC.

Kima MHEC is a cellulose-based polymer that is commonly used in mortars to control water loss during the setting and curing process. By modifying the rheological properties of the mortar, Kima MHEC helps to improve workability, reduce water loss, and enhance the overall performance of the material. This is particularly important in applications where water retention is critical, such as in hot or windy conditions, or when working with highly absorbent substrates.

One of the key benefits of using Kima MHEC in mortars is its ability to improve the consistency and workability of the material. By reducing water loss, the polymer helps to maintain a more uniform and stable mix, making it easier to place and finish the mortar. This not only saves time and labor costs but also ensures a more consistent and high-quality finish.

In addition to improving workability, Kima MHEC also helps to enhance the strength and durability of mortars. By controlling water loss, the polymer promotes more efficient hydration of cement particles, resulting in a denser and more cohesive matrix. This leads to increased bond strength, reduced shrinkage, and improved resistance to cracking and weathering. As a result, mortars fortified with Kima MHEC are better able to withstand the rigors of construction and provide long-lasting performance.

Techniques for Water Loss Prevention in Mortars

Water loss in mortars can be a significant issue that affects the overall quality and durability of the finished product. Excessive water loss can lead to a variety of problems, including reduced workability, poor bond strength, and increased cracking. To combat these issues, many manufacturers turn to chemical admixtures like Kima MHEC.

Kima MHEC is a cellulose-based polymer that is commonly used in mortars to control water loss. This admixture works by forming a protective film around the cement particles, which helps to slow down the evaporation of water from the mortar. By reducing the rate of water loss, Kima MHEC can help to improve the workability of the mortar, increase bond strength, and reduce the likelihood of cracking.

One of the key benefits of using Kima MHEC is its ability to improve the workability of the mortar. When water evaporates too quickly from the mortar, it can become stiff and difficult to work with. This can make it challenging to properly place and finish the mortar, leading to a subpar final product. By slowing down the rate of water loss, Kima MHEC helps to keep the mortar in a more workable state for a longer period of time, making it easier to handle and manipulate.

In addition to improving workability, Kima MHEC can also help to increase the bond strength of the mortar. When water evaporates too quickly from the mortar, it can leave behind voids and gaps in the material. These voids can weaken the bond between the mortar and the substrate, leading to reduced overall strength. By forming a protective film around the cement particles, Kima MHEC helps to fill in these voids and create a stronger, more durable bond.

Furthermore, Kima MHEC can help to reduce the likelihood of cracking in the finished mortar. Cracking is a common issue that can occur when water evaporates too quickly from the mortar, causing it to shrink and pull away from the substrate. By slowing down the rate of water loss, Kima MHEC helps to minimize the risk of cracking, ensuring that the finished product remains structurally sound and aesthetically pleasing.
